Flying High: Hornets Women Open Their First NCAA Tourney Saturday

  • fave
  • like
  • share

By Antonio R. Harvey | OBSERVER Staff Writer The Sacramento State women’s basketball team is on its way to face the No. 4-seeded UCLA Bruins in Los Angeles on Saturday, March 18, in the first round of 2023 NCAA Women's Basketball Championships. The 13th-seed Hornets (25-7) make their first NCAA Tournament appearance after winning the […]
